The fight scenes ended up closely choreographed, nevertheless the actors were necessary to "go entire out" to capture practical effects including obtaining the wind knocked out of them.[21] Make-up artist Julie Pearce, who experienced labored for Fincher around the 1997 movie The Game, examined blended martial arts and pay back-for every-view boxing to portray the fighters correctly. She designed an additional's ear to own cartilage lacking, inspired via the boxing match by which Mike Tyson bit off Component of Evander Holyfield's ear.
